Hyde, Patricia; Clayton, Berwyn; Booth, Robin – National Centre for Vocational Education Research (NCVER), 2004
This report highlights the diversity of assessment methods used in flexible delivery modes of teaching across Australia's vocational education and training (VET) sector. While assessment practice is underpinned by training package and course curriculum requirements, other factors influence the methods teachers and assessors choose. These include…

Baade, Sandra Lee – 1990
A study was conducted to ascertain the extent to which instructors incorporated reading- and writing-to-learn skills and strategies into the methods courses of secondary social studies preparation programs. A questionnaire was mailed to the instructors of social studies methods courses at the colleges and universities in Region Four of the Teacher…
